Freight Shipping Planner CLdN is a leading provider of integrated quay-to-quay and door-to-door logistics solutions. Founded in 1929, CLdN ensures reliable, cost-effective transport that links the major economic areas of Europe. With 30 ships and more than 200 sailings a week, CLdN provides shortsea connections between the European continent, the United Kingdom, Ireland, Iberia and Scandinavia and offers the lowest CO2 footprint of all Western European RoRo operators. CLdN’s cargo and multimodal services have a Europe-wide reach using CLdN’s extensive network of ships, terminals and equipment. CLdN’s 3,000 employees ensure that it fulfills its mission: to excel as an integrated provider of maritime links. Within this challenging role, you will you will process cargo bookings and plan all the different types of export cargo on each vessel. Your role To liaise with customers via telephone, C-web and e-mail giving them up-to-date information on their cargo. Processing all custom clearances required and updating lists for invoicing. Ensure that the vessels are utilised to full capacity. Collating various manifests for each vessel within the fleet. Liaising with Port Authorities/Regulatory Authorities/HMRC. Monitoring customs holds and assist in getting them cleared for shipment. Liaising with port and terminal staff to ensure smooth and efficient running of the vessel and terminal operations. Using Microsoft Excel, Word and Outlook systems. Carry out any duties and tasks as directed by the Route Manager. This role requires you to work a shift pattern, working between 0600-0600 hours Monday to Sunday (24-hour operation) on a roster basis. Your profile Have knowledge of customs processes import and export. Preferably have knowledge of the Destin8 system. Have experience within shipping Be able to work well under pressure, meeting deadlines Have a high degree of flexibility Be able to work on their own initiative Good communication skills, customer services skills and IT skills Ability to multi-task is essential.
